π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

Place potatoes, onions and baby carrots in slow-cooker.

Add bell pepper and beef.

In small bowl, combine broth or bouillon, oregano, paprika, parsley, Worcestershire sauce, salt and pepper. Pour over meat and vegetables.

Cover and cook on LOW 9-10 hours. Turn pot on HIGH.

In small bowl, dissolve cornstarch in water; stir into cooked stew mixture.

Cover and cook on HIGH 15-20 minutes or until thickened, stirring occasionally.

Makes 6 or 7 servings.
